ウェブページでの水平スクロールの実装方法と考慮すべきポイント


  1. CSS overflow-x プロパティを使用する方法: CSSのoverflow-xプロパティを使用して、特定の要素内で水平スクロールを有効にすることができます。以下は例です:

    .scrollable-container {
     overflow-x: auto;
    }

    上記の例では、classが「scrollable-container」の要素内で水平スクロールが有効になります。必要に応じて、幅やスタイルを調整してください。

  2. JavaScriptを使用する方法: JavaScriptを使って、より高度な水平スクロール機能を実装することもできます。以下は、JavaScriptを使用して水平スクロールを制御する例です:

    var scrollableElement = document.getElementById('scrollable-element');
    scrollableElement.scrollLeft += 100; // 100ピクセル右にスクロールする例

    上記の例では、idが「scrollable-element」の要素を取得し、scrollLeftプロパティを使用して水平方向にスクロールしています。必要に応じて、スクロール量やトリガー条件を調整してください。

  3. ライブラリやフレームワークを使用する方法: 水平スクロールの実装を簡略化するために、さまざまなライブラリやフレームワークが提供されています。例えば、jQueryやReactなどのフレームワークを使用することで、水平スクロール機能を簡単に実装することができます。詳細な使用方法は各ライブラリやフレームワークのドキュメントを参照してください。

以上が、ウェブページでの水平スクロールの実装方法と考慮すべきポイントの概要です。必要に応じて、具体的な要件やデザインに合わせてコードを調整してください。